Please see CUSMA Chapter 4 (Rules of Origin). … WitrynaWhat is an ordinary Certificate of Origin? A Certificate of Origin (CO) helps to attest the origin of goods. There are two types of COs, namely ordinary COs and preferential COs. An ordinary CO, also known as a non-preferential CO, is a trade document that helps to identify the origin of the good.
